Recommend a good cheap fault code reader?

I need one that can read/clear faults. Ebay seems hit and miss, with some not able to do what others can. I need one that can do as much as possible, without it being silly money. Ideally £20-25.
Cheers all.
 
I'd get a cheap ELM327 USB or Bluetooth adapter.

Then you can read fault codes on your laptop or android smart phone.

There are Wifi ones that'll work with certain iPhone apps, but I have no experience of them.
